## Break-Glass Access — Slimtainer Pipeline

If the Slimtainer image-slimming job wedges a release, you can break glass and push the unslimmed base image directly. Heads up: this bypasses the layer-dedup checks, so flag it in the release notes. Break-glass requires unlocking the Corvid emergency vault, and the recovery passphrase you'll need is right here below.

unlock words, hahip-baduf: holwyn-istath-julvan

Hey Mirelle,

Handing off the Festiq ticket-pricing experiment before I'm out next week. The variant tables live in the pricing_exp schema — support folks may ask why some customers see odd fares, so point them at the experiment_assignments table first. Rollback script is in the usual repo. If you need to poke at the data directly, connect with the string below.

database URL for bagap-yahap: mysql://druax_svc:s0i8rHw@db-fdc1.orvexworks.local:5432/druius

Handover — Vexler partner SFTP drop

Ownership moves to you today. Drop runs hourly from Vexler's end into the intake bucket via the relay host. Watch for zero-byte files; their exporter flakes on Mondays. Creds live in the ops vault, path noted in the runbook. Vault auto-seals after 48h idle. Support escalations go to the on-call rotation, not me. If the vault is sealed when you need it, unseal with the recovery passphrase below.

recovery phrase for tadug-fafof: zorwyn-kasion

// Seat-map renderer constants — Gildhall Theatre project.
// New folks: these values control how the Proscenia renderer lays out
// seats at each zoom tier. They were tuned against the largest venue we
// support (the Aldercote main hall, ~2,300 seats) so panning stays smooth
// on mid-range tablets. Changing one usually means re-checking the others,
// since tile size and label thresholds interact. The current set follows.

tuning constants:
QUOTAS = {
    "druwyn": 5,
    "holix": 5,
    "zorath": 5,
    "holwyn": 10,
}